Sometimes. It depends on the policy wording which needs to be read and understood before taking passengers, whether it be a wife, friend or other non-employee. Truckers Liability claims tend to payout big since accidents can be catastrophic and big rigs can do more damage than say a Geo Metro. Some policies stopped allowing a passenger because it effectively doubled the risk and cost of injuries to those traveling in the truck. It would not be appropriate for an employee-trucker to ask if his wife can be added to the company's insurance policy. This exception may only be considered if the trucker is an owner operator where she is automatically included or can be added as named insured.

The most common health issue faced by OTR truck drivers is exhaustion, caused by driving for long periods without sleep. If the driver continuously uses drugs to help them stay awake while driving, they run the risk of addiction, as well.

When downshifting you let the truck run at a low rpm like around 1200 then easly take it out of gear and then rev the truck up about 300 rpm while shifting into the lower gear. Eventually you will get the feel of the truck and sound and will be able to do it in your sleep.
